Two American soldiers are forced to parachute into a small German town during World War II. They are taken in by Herr Frick, a patriotic and lonely man who keeps them as prisoners of war in his bomb shelter. As the days pass, the soldiers grow restless, while Herr Frick struggles with the decision of whether to reveal the war's end and potentially lose their companionship.
